Pistachio Tres Leches Cake

Description

Soft and moist sponge cake is smothered in a 3-milk mixture that is flavoured with pistachio cream, then topped with delicate whipped cream.

Ingredients
    Sponge Cake
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p ground cardamom
  • 6 large eggs, yolks and whites separated (room temperature)
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 2/3 cup whole milk (room temperature)
  • few drops green food colouring (optional)
  • Milk Mixture
  • 354 mL (12 oz) evaporated milk
  • 300 mL (14 oz) sweetened condensed milk
  • 1/2 cup whole milk
  • 3 tbsp pistachio cream (adjust to taste)
  • 1/2 tsp ground cardamom
  • Topping
  • 2 cups whipping cream (heavy cream) (cold)
  • 1/4 cup icing sugar (confectioners sugar) (sifted)
  • pistachios, finely chopped (garnish)
  • edible rose petals (garnish)
  • pistachio cream (garnish)
Instructions
  1. 1

    Preheat oven to 350F and lightly grease the bottom of a 9x13 inch baking pan. Do not grease the sides. Set aside. 

  2. 2

    In a small bowl, mix together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, salt, and ground cardamom. Set aside. 

  3. 3

    Separate the whites and yolks of the eggs. Place the yolks in a large bowl and the whites in a large metal bowl. Set aside the yolks for now. 

  4. 4

    Beat the egg whites with a hand mixer or stand mixer on medium for 1-2 minutes. Add about 2 tbsp of the granulated sugar and continue to beat for a few more minutes, until medium-stiff peaks are achieved. You should be able to hold the bowl upside down without any of the whites dropping out. Set this aside. 

  5. 5

    Add the remaining sugar to the bowl of yolks and beat until pale and creamy, which takes a couple minutes. 

  6. 6

    Add the milk and food colouring (optional) to the yolks and beat until combined. 

  7. 7

    Add in half of the flour mixture and beat to combine. Add in the other half of the flour mixture and beat until just combined. 

  8. 8

    To the batter, add in 1/3 of the beaten egg whites and fold in very gently with a spatula. Add in another 1/3 of the whites and fold in. Add in the last 1/3 of egg whites and fold in gently once again, until just combined. This part is important: you want to be very gentle and do not overmix because the cake will not be fluffy and it will deflate. 

  9. 9

    Gently pour into the prepared baking pan and bake for 20-25 minutes. Check doneness with a toothpick. Stick the toothpick into the center of the cake. If it comes out clean, it's done. 

  10. 10

    Once finished, place the pan on a baking rack and allow the cake to cool. 

  11. 11

    While the cake is cooling, make the milk mixture. Combine the evaporated milk, condensed milk, whole milk, pistachio cream, and ground cardamom, and whisk until everything is thoroughly combined. You can taste the mixture at this point. If the pistachio taste isn't strong enough for you, add another tbsp of pistachio cream and whisk once more. Set aside until cake it cool. 

  12. 12

    Once cake is cool, you can use a fork or skewer to poke multiple holes over the entire top of the the cake. Just do not poke all the way down to the bottom. The cake should not be removed from the pan. 

  13. 13

    Slowly pour the milk mixture all over the top of the cake, ensuring you pour over the edges as well. It will take some time for the cake to fully absorb the milk. 

  14. 14

    Cover the cake with plastic wrap and refrigerate overnight. 

  15. 15

    The milk should be fully absorbed by now, but it is okay to have a small amount of milk not absorbed. 

  16. 16

    In a medium sized bowl, combine the whipping cream and icing sugar. Beat together using a hand or stand mixer until you get medium to stiff peaks. 

  17. 17

    Spread the whipped cream onto the cake any way that you'd like. Garnish with finely chopped pistachios, edible rose petals, and pistachio cream, if desired. 

  18. 18

    This cake should be kept in the fridge and served cold. Enjoy!
